Genesys Cloud vs Talkdesk 2026: Advisor Verdict

Genesys

CCaaS & Contact Center

The deepest platform in the category; buy it for orchestration, not for simplicity.

Best for: enterprise omnichannel at scale

Genesys Cloud CX is what large operations choose when the contact center is central to the business. Its routing and orchestration are the strongest in the category, workforce engagement is native rather than an acquisition stapled on, and the platform absorbs complex, multi step customer journeys that force rivals into workarounds. The natural fit starts around a hundred agents and runs into the thousands, especially where IT wants one strategic platform instead of a stack of point tools. Below that size, much of what you are paying for sits unused. Pricing behaves like enterprise software: approachable list tiers, with AI, add ons, and consumption charges carrying real weight in the final number, so model the full bill rather than the seat price. Support and the partner ecosystem are deep, and the company's long history in contact center shows in the edge cases it already handles. Plan a serious implementation; this is a platform you deploy, not a tool you turn on.

Talkdesk

CCaaS & Contact Center

The fastest route from signed contract to live agents among the majors.

Best for: mid market teams that value speed

Talkdesk's defining trait is speed. Deployments that take the enterprise heavyweights a quarter routinely go live on Talkdesk in weeks, and day to day changes, a new flow, a new queue, a tweaked IVR, happen in the admin console without a ticket to IT. The product feels modern because it is: agent and supervisor experiences are clean, and the industry editions for healthcare, financial services, and retail ship with domain workflows rather than marketing labels. The sweet spot is mid market teams, roughly 20 to a few hundred agents, that want enterprise capability without enterprise ceremony. At the extreme high end of complexity, the enterprise heavyweights still out muscle it. Published pricing assumes a three year commitment, and Talkdesk is one of the most aggressive negotiators in the category when it knows it is in a bake off, which makes it a valuable contender in any competitive process.

Advisor Verdict

Depth against speed. Genesys Cloud CX is the platform large enterprises consolidate onto: the strongest orchestration and routing in the category, with workforce engagement built in rather than bolted on. Talkdesk is the platform that gets teams live in weeks where the enterprise names take quarters, with an interface admins change without opening a ticket to IT. Both are serious; they are optimized for different sizes of problem.

List prices as published in July 2026; both platforms quote below list in competitive deals, Genesys prices AI by consumption on top of its tiers, and Talkdesk's published pricing assumes a three year term.
ProviderList priceSweet spotStandout
Genesys Cloud CX$75 to $155 /user/mo + AILarge enterpriseOrchestration depth
Talkdesk$85 to $145 /user/moMid marketSpeed to deploy

Choose Genesys Cloud when

  • You run a large estate with complex customer journeys across many touchpoints
  • Predictive routing and journey orchestration are the actual requirement
  • Workforce engagement inside the same platform will replace separate tools
  • You are consolidating multiple contact center systems onto one long term standard

Choose Talkdesk when

  • You need to be live in weeks, not quarters
  • Admins should change flows and routing themselves, without a ticket to IT
  • Healthcare or financial services workflows in its industry editions match your business
  • You are mid market and want a vendor that competes aggressively on price in live deals

The pricing reality

Genesys tiers run $75 to $155 per user per month with AI priced by consumption on top, and real Genesys costs commonly pass the list tiers once add ons enter the proposal. Talkdesk publishes $85 to $145 per user per month on a three year commitment and is one of the most aggressive price competitors in the category when a deal is contested. Neither number is comparable off the sheet: the Genesys AI line has to be modeled against your volumes, and the Talkdesk term has to fit how long you are willing to commit.

The verdict by use case: large enterprises with genuine journey complexity, roughly 100 agents and up, are the businesses Genesys was built for; mid market operations that value speed, admin self sufficiency, and price competition should start with Talkdesk.
